PC World‘s review Edit

In the end, the Vizio CA24T-A4 All-In-One PC is a good-looking and rather pricey disappointment. The design, sound, ports, and extras are top notch; the display, keyboard and performance are not. It's almost as if the CA24T-A4 were designed to be used from a distance on a couch, as you would use a TV, not sitting up close where you need to be for any serious sort of computing. Here's hoping Vizio corrects its mistakes next go-round. If it does, there are a lot of PC vendors that should be worried.

computershopper‘s review Edit

We've said it before, and we'll say it again: all-in-ones may be the hardware sleeper stars of Windows 8, with big displays and touch-screen capabilities that cast Microsoft's new operating system in the best light possible. Vizio's refresh of its all-in-one lineup transforms the series from an also-ran into a serious computing contender for folks who want a finger-friendly display. The sleek, silver aesthetic stuns despite the abundant use of plastic, creating a minimalistic appeal that would look right at home in an office, kitchen, or den. Thanks to the discrete subwoofer and bright, responsive touch screen, the CA24T-A4 oozes sensory satisfaction in spades. We also love the thoughtful touches Vizio packs in with the computer, such as the media remote and the Microsoft Signature software experience.

CNET Reviews‘s review Edit

As with the 27-inch model, my overall impression of the CA24T-A4 is that Vizio has designed this system for maximum retail shelf appeal. It looks nice, and it has just enough features to make its price tag seem reasonable. Further scrutiny reveals the cracks in this approach if you're shopping on strength of features for the dollar. From Asus in particular, you can buy more computer for basically the same price.
